Output 651881e941b8781dd74d5fa3d443e37d9d85099c60fccfc4c9cff2ce28216f6e:1

value
11531161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0abc04889117d5ca12f99e221561c7c09d7e9d50 OP_EQUAL
address
M8svE3jULhHmR5nFh5q8ce6DjMkmi6JKFw
transaction
651881e941b8781dd74d5fa3d443e37d9d85099c60fccfc4c9cff2ce28216f6e
spent
true